Duties/Responsibilities

  • Assembles and installs a variety of metal and non-metal pipe fittings, including those made of brass, copper, lead, glass, and plastic
  • Cuts, threads, and bends the pipe
  • Inspects work sites to determine the presence of obstructions and to ascertain that holes will not cause structural weakness
  • Installs and maintains refrigeration and air-conditioning systems, including compressors, pumps, meters, pneumatic and hydraulic controls, and piping
  • Joins pipe using threaded, caulked, soldered, brazed, fused, or cemented joints
  • Plans the sequence of installation to avoid obstructions and activities of other construction workers
  • Secures pipe to structure with clamps, brackets, and hangers
  • Selects the size and type of pipe and related material according to job specifications
  • Test the piping system for leaks
